Waste counters doesn't have any relation to how much time did user used the printer. Waste counters increase when printhead cleaning is performed. One printhead cleaning takes about 3-4% of waste counter. So if user make 25-30 printhead cleanings - the waste ink counters will reach 100% and overflow. Doesn't depend on time you will make this cleanings - in 1 month or in 1 year or in 1 day or in 3 years. Usually when printer is new and using Epson original inks - -there will be no need to make printhead cleanings. After Epson inks finish - users often buy third party inks - they have not so good quality as Epson and may clog printhead more often. So after Epson inks finish - users make printhead cleanings more often - as a result - after 20-30 printhead cleanings - counters overflow. So - try to make printhead cleanings less often.
Only ONE thing what does Reset Key - it resets waste ink pads counters to ZERO. Doesn't matter counters will be reset by yourself using Reset key ($9.99) or by Epson Service Center engineer ($50) - the result will be the same - counters will become 0%
Conclusion: use high quality inks!
